Host removed AC from listing after booking.

I booked a Paris Airbnb months ago with AC listed.

Two days ago, I checked the listing and AC is gone from the listing. I know it was there because I texted my friend the link specifically mentioning it had AC, and I used Airbnb's share feature, which had "amenities facilities=air conditioning" right in the URL. Unfortunately, I didn't screenshot the listing as proof because why would I?!

The host hasn't responded in 48 hours. I contacted VRBO, who also couldn't reach them. When I followed up a day later, their manager told me they have no way of knowing if a host removed an amenit, which is complete BS. They clearly have access to listing change logs. After I showed them the URL with the AC filter, they reached out to the host again.

Their solution? If the host doesn't respond before I arrive in 4 days, I should just show up, check for AC myself, and then call them to find a replacement. I'm not spending 2-3 hours on the phone hunting for a place to stay in Paris with no backup plan.

I threatened a chargeback and suddenly they got slightly more helpful. They're supposed to contact me today with a "resolution" (their word, said very vaguely and would not tell me what it meant), assuming they don't hear from the host.

Any advice on dealing with this? The entire reason we booked this place was that it had AC and we definitely paid a premium for it.
